About this book

Can development be decoupled from carbon emissions? This insightful guide outlines practical steps for policymakers, academics, and development practitioners to achieve a zero-carbon future while fostering economic growth and protecting vulnerable populations.

Decarbonizing Development tackles the complex challenge of climate change by offering a three-pronged approach:

  • Planning with the end goal in mind
  • Implementing policy packages that incentivize technological innovation and behavioral changes
  • Managing the transition to protect the poor and avoid concentrated losses

Discover how countries can navigate the transition to a sustainable, low-carbon economy, ensuring a more equitable and prosperous future for all. A must-read for anyone concerned with climate change and global development. Written by Marianne Fay, Stephane Hallegatte, and team.
